Add custom rewind and forward buttons to YouTube video player

šŸŽ¬ YtScroll - Custom Playback Buttons for YouTube Take control of your YouTube viewing experience with custom skip buttons directly in the video player! ✨ FEATURES: - Add skip buttons (-30s, -15s, -10s, +10s, +15s, +30s) to the YouTube player - Skip forward or backward with a single click - Fully customizable intervals through the options page - Seamless integration with YouTube's native controls - Works on all YouTube videos - Lightweight and fast - no performance impact - No ads, no tracking, completely free šŸŽÆ PERFECT FOR: - Skipping intros and outros - Rewinding to catch missed moments - Navigating long videos and tutorials - Podcast and lecture viewers - Anyone who wants more control over video playback āš™ļø HOW TO USE: 1. Install the extension 2. Go to any YouTube video 3. See the new skip buttons next to the time display 4. Click to skip forward or backward instantly! šŸ”§ CUSTOMIZATION: Right-click the extension icon → Options to customize your button intervals. šŸ“ PERMISSIONS: - Storage: Save your custom button preferences - YouTube access: Inject buttons into the player Made with ā¤ļø for YouTube viewers who want more control.
